Source
Thrown at go/vt/mysqlctl/xtrabackupengine.go:743
if compressed {
var decompressor io.ReadCloser
deCompressionEngine := bm.CompressionEngine
if deCompressionEngine == "" {
// For backward compatibility. Incase if Manifest is from N-1 binary
// then we assign the default value of compressionEngine.
deCompressionEngine = PgzipCompressor
}
externalDecompressorCmd := resolveExternalDecompressor(bm.ExternalDecompressor)
if externalDecompressorCmd != "" {
if deCompressionEngine == ExternalCompressor {
deCompressionEngine = externalDecompressorCmd
decompressor, err = newExternalDecompressor(ctx, deCompressionEngine, reader, logger)
} else {
decompressor, err = newBuiltinDecompressor(deCompressionEngine, reader, logger)
}
} else {
if deCompressionEngine == ExternalCompressor {
return fmt.Errorf("%w %q", errUnsupportedCompressionEngine, ExternalCompressor)
}
decompressor, err = newBuiltinDecompressor(deCompressionEngine, reader, logger)
}
if err != nil {
return vterrors.Wrap(err, "can't create decompressor")
}
srcDecompressors = append(srcDecompressors, ioutil.NewTimeoutCloser(ctx, decompressor, closeTimeout))
reader = decompressor
}
srcReaders = append(srcReaders, reader)
}
